WebHeart palpitations. The most obvious symptom of atrial fibrillation is heart palpitations – where the heart feels like it's pounding, fluttering or beating irregularly, often for a few seconds or possibly a few minutes. As well as an irregular heartbeat, your heart may also beat very fast (often considerably higher than 100 beats per minute).
